| 			| File Writer - Append | 									| Language: | Server Sided ASP - JavaScript |  				| Author: | Jon Lokken |  				| Date: | 7-24-2008 |  |  		| 
 |  		| Description: | View Example |  		| Using the ASP file system object to write to a file.  		Make sure you set your permissions to read/write on the application 		server. |  
 <%@ LANGUAGE="JavaScript" %><% Response.buffer=true %>
 <%
 var myReturn = "\u000A";
 var myTab = "\u0009";
 var myVerticalTab = "\u000B";
 var myFormFeed = "\u000C";
 var myCarriageReturn = "\u000D";
 
 var objMyFSO = Server.CreateObject("Scripting.FileSystemObject");
 var serverPath = Server.MapPath("/applications/programming/ASP/FileSystemObject/formData.txt");
 var doesFileExist = objMyFSO.FileExists(serverPath);
 
 if(doesFileExist){
 // Read the file
 var pageTStream = objMyFSO.OpenTextFile(serverPath);
 var pageContents = "";
 var lineNumber = 0;
 while(! pageTStream.AtEndOfStream){
 var temp = "" + pageTStream.Readline() + "<br>";
 pageContents = pageContents + temp + "";
 lineNumber++;
 }
 Response.Write(pageContents);
 pageTStream.close();
 
 // Write to the file
 <%
 pageTStream = objMyFSO.OpenTextFile(serverPath,8,true);
 pageTStream.WriteLine("\"New User"+lineNumber+"\",\"Lokken\",\"001\",\"1 Smith Rd\",\"Minneapolis\",\"MN\",\"55555\",\"612-333-3333\"");
 pageTStream.close();
 } else{
 Response.Write("The page has been moved or deleted from the server.");
 }
 %>
 
 
 			| Disclaimer: |  		| Feel free to use this code I have written.  I take no responsibility for this 		code working, imply no warranty as to it's validity, and will not be 		held liable if you decide to try it.  I am only trying to help out 		others so they don't have to struggle with the same problems as me... |  |